Frequently asked questions about hotels in Dominican Republic

  • What are the best landmarks to visit?

    For iconic landmarks, you absolutely must see the Colonial Zone in Santo Domingo, a UNESCO World Heritage site. The First Cathedral of America, Alcázar de Colón, and the Ozama Fortress are highlights. Elsewhere, Los Tres Ojos National Park near Santo Domingo offers stunning cave pools, while the 27 Charcos of Damajagua in Puerto Plata provides a thrilling waterfall adventure. For breathtaking scenery, consider the Salto El Limón waterfall in Samaná.

  • What are some must-do activities?

    The Dominican Republic offers diverse activities. Relax on the beautiful beaches of Punta Cana or Bávaro, famed for their white sand and turquoise waters. Explore the lush rainforests, perhaps taking a guided hike or zip-lining through the canopy. For a cultural experience, visit a local cigar factory or a coffee plantation. Whale watching tours in Samaná Bay (January-March) are unforgettable.

  • When is the ideal time to visit?

    The best time to visit is generally during the dry season, from December to April, when temperatures are pleasant and rainfall is minimal. However, prices tend to be higher during this peak season. The shoulder seasons (May-June and September-November) offer a good balance of pleasant weather and fewer crowds.

  • Is renting a car recommended for exploring?

    Renting a car can be beneficial for exploring beyond major tourist areas, but it's important to be aware of the driving conditions. Roads outside of main cities can be poorly maintained, and driving can be challenging. Consider your comfort level and the areas you plan to visit before deciding.

  • Are credit cards widely accepted?

    Credit cards, particularly Visa and Mastercard, are accepted in most larger hotels, restaurants, and shops, especially in tourist areas. However, it's always wise to carry some Dominican pesos for smaller establishments and local markets.
  • What are the largest airports?

    The two largest airports are Punta Cana International Airport (PUJ) and Las Américas International Airport (SDQ) in Santo Domingo. These are the main gateways for international flights.
  • Are there any unwritten rules of behaviour visitors should know about?

    Dominicans are generally friendly and welcoming. Learning a few basic Spanish phrases is appreciated. It's considered polite to greet people with a handshake or a kiss on the cheek (depending on the relationship). Bargaining is common in markets, but always do so respectfully.
  • What local specialities should you try?

    Don't miss trying La Bandera (the national dish: stewed meat, rice, beans), mofongo (fried plantain dish), sancocho (a hearty stew), and fresh seafood. For dessert, try dulce de leche and the local fruit, such as mangoes and pineapples.
  • Where are the best shopping spots?

    The Colonial Zone in Santo Domingo offers a variety of shops selling souvenirs, crafts, and amber. Punta Cana also has numerous shops in the resort areas and malls. For a more local experience, explore smaller markets in towns and cities outside of the major tourist hubs.
  • What signature events or festivals take place?

    Carnival is celebrated across the country, with vibrant parades and costumes. The patron saint festivals (fiestas patronales) are held throughout the year in different towns and cities, offering a glimpse into local traditions. The Merengue Festival is a significant musical event.
  • What’s the best place for mild and comfortable weather?

    The areas around Santo Domingo and Puerto Plata generally offer mild and comfortable weather year-round, although temperatures can vary depending on the season. The mountain regions offer cooler temperatures.
  • What are the most common travel mistakes tourists make?

    Common mistakes include not exchanging currency before arrival (rates can be less favourable at the airport), not learning basic Spanish phrases, and overestimating the quality of roads outside of major tourist areas when renting a car.
  • What are some hidden gems to explore?

    Jarabacoa offers stunning mountain scenery and opportunities for adventure activities such as white-water rafting. Los Haitises National Park boasts impressive limestone karsts and mangrove forests. The Samaná Peninsula, beyond the tourist hotspots, offers secluded beaches and charming fishing villages.
